LUTCHER v. UNITED STATES

No. 271.

157 U.S. 427 (1895)

LUTCHER v. UNITED STATES.

Supreme Court of United States.

Decided April 8, 1895.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Mr. J.L. Bradford for plaintiffs in error.

Mr. Solicitor General for defendants in error.


THE CHIEF JUSTICE:

This was an action brought by the United States in the Circuit Court of the United States for the Eastern District of Texas against the firm of Lutcher & Moore of that district, doing a milling and manufacturing business at Orange, Texas, to recover damages for cutting, carrying away, and converting to their own use certain timber, the property of the United States.
